The Use Of A Real Time Online Class Response System To Enhance Classroom Learning, Lulu Sun Jun 2016

The Use Of A Real Time Online Class Response System To Enhance Classroom Learning, Lulu Sun

Lulu Sun

A real time online class response system was used in class to quickly query student population’s grasp of concepts, engage class participation, check their attendance, and clarify any misconceptions. The biggest challenges for the instructor are time needed to learn the new system, creating effective concept questions, adequate coverage of course material, and ability to respond to instantaneous student feedback. Student challenges include increased confusion if inappropriate wording for the questions, and a negative reaction to the approach in general. Overall this is a highly flexible use of interactive technology for engaging students in any discipline during the class time.

A Second Language Acquisition Approach To Learning Programming Languages, Rachel Cunningham, Paula Sanjuan Espejo, Christina Frederick, Lulu Sun, Li Ding Jun 2016

A Second Language Acquisition Approach To Learning Programming Languages, Rachel Cunningham, Paula Sanjuan Espejo, Christina Frederick, Lulu Sun, Li Ding

Lulu Sun

The instructional design for modules in the study was based on the evidence that learning a programming language is analogous to students acquiring a second language, and utilized tools from Second Language Acquisition (SLA) theory. A programming language has vocabulary, syntax, grammar and communicative outcomes that must be sufficiently developed for the learner to function successfully in the environment that utilizes the language. This proposed study utilized an SLA approach to programming language in a blended learning environment.
